skye's spicy 3 bean chili
- 1 lb ground lean beef or turkey (I usually use turkey or a 50/50 blend)
- 1 can (15.5 oz) light or dark red kidney be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(15.5 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(15.5 oz) of your favorite spicy chili beans, retaining the yummy sauce
- 1 can (10 oz) diced tomatoes and green chilies (I like the rotel brand... but use what you like)
- 1 can (15 oz) tomato sauce
- 1 medium green pepper, diced
- 1 small onion, diced
- 1 tbsp minced garlic
- 1 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p ground cumin
- 1 tsp (or more) red pepper flake, depends on how spicy you want it
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 salt and pepper to taste
- I like to start my chili early.
- I open all 3 cans of beans.
- drain and rinse kidney and black beans.
- then, in a large bowl, mix them with the can of spicy chili beans and let them "marinade" together for atleast an hour or two before I start cooking.
- next he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large pot and add your ground meat.
- season lightly with salt and peppee and cook thoroughly.
- next add in your minced garlic, onion, green pepper and red pepper flake and cook together with ground meat until the onions and peppers start to soften.
- add in your beans, tomatoes, tomato sauce and spices.
- .. turn down heat to low and allow everything to simmer no shorter than 1 hour.
- the longer it simmers... the better it will taste.
- serve by itself... or top it withshredded sharp cheddar cheese, sour cream, crackers, an extra splash of hot sauce.
- .. or any combination of those yummy toppings
